WANGAEHU HIGHWAY BOARD NOTICE OF STOPPAGE OF ROAD NOTICE is hereby given that the Wangaehu Highway Board purpose closing a portion of the Great Eastern line passing through the Wiritoa property, it being im: practicable for traffic, with a view of exchanging it with the owners of the said property for a practicable road. Plans of the road proposed to be stopped, and of the one to be taken in exchange, are now open for inspection at the office of tbe said Board, Eutland Chambers, Eidgwaystreet, Wanganui. EDWARD N. LIFPITON, Secretary Wangaehu Highway Board. Wanganu^, May 25th, 1880, BY APPOINTMENT. fTIHIS is to notify that goods Dyed -*- at A.
